Technical Specifications
- Brand: Yokogawa
- Model Number: AAI143-S00
- Product Type: Standard basic type analog input module
- Measurement Range: Processes standard 4 to 20 mA DC field input signals
- Input Channels: 16 fully isolated channels protect system logic circuitry
- Allowable Input Current: Handles up to 24 mA maximum current per channel
- Withstanding Voltage: Provides 1500 V AC isolation for 1 minute between input and system
- Power ON Resistance: Ranges from 270 Ω at 20 mA to 350 Ω at 4 mA
- Power OFF Resistance: Maintains a high impedance of 500 kΩ or larger
- Module Accuracy: Delivers precise measurement within a tight ±16 µA tolerance
- Data Update Period: Refreshes all channel data rapidly every 10 ms
- Transmitter Power Supply: Delivers 19.0 V or higher with a 25.5 V maximum open-circuit voltage
- Output Current Limit: Restricts loop current to 25 mA to shield field equipment
- Temperature Drift: Limits thermal variance to ±16 µA per 10 °C change

- Current Consumption: Consumes 230 mA from 5 V DC and 540 mA from 24 V DC
- Weight: Lightweight physical design weighs exactly 0.3 Kg
Equipment Compatibility
The Yokogawa AAI143-S00 integrates natively into specific control systems and field hardware setups.
- Integrates perfectly with Yokogawa Centum VP and Centum CS 3000 distributed control systems
- Fits into standard field control station node units and I/O expansion cabinets
- Accepts input from any standard 2-wire or 4-wire process control transmitters
- Connects via pressure clamp terminals, MIL connector cables, or dedicated KS1 cables

Frequently Asked Questions
Question: How do I change a channel from 2-wire to 4-wire transmitter configuration?
Answer: You must configure the physical setting pins located on the side of the module for each independent channel.
Question: What happens to the input resistance when the system loses power?
Answer: The input resistance shifts to 500 kΩ or larger to protect the field loop instrumentation.
Question: Can this module supply power directly to a field transmitter?
Answer: Yes, the built-in transmitter power supply provides 19.0 V or higher for 2-wire current loops.
